Creating a Strong Visual Identity

Your booth is an extension of your brand. A consistent visual identity — including logo placement, color palette, typography, and imagery — ensures instant recognition. When visitors enter the exhibition hall, your booth should immediately communicate who you are and what you represent. Vibrant visuals, well-positioned signage, and a clean layout help your brand stand out amid the crowd, while a cohesive design reinforces professionalism and credibility.

Aligning Design with Brand Message

Effective branding goes beyond looks; it’s about delivering a message that resonates. The booth design should reflect your company’s mission, values, and tone. For example, a tech brand may choose a sleek, modern layout with digital displays, while a sustainability-focused company might use natural textures and green elements. Aligning every design aspect — from furniture to lighting — with your brand message ensures that visitors not only remember your visuals but also understand your story.

Enhancing Engagement and Brand Recall

A branded booth can significantly enhance visitor engagement. Interactive displays, product demonstrations, and branded giveaways help create meaningful experiences. When people interact with your booth, they connect emotionally with your brand — leading to stronger recall even after the event. Incorporating branded touchpoints such as digital screens, custom uniforms, or immersive experiences ensures your booth remains in visitors’ minds long after they leave the exhibition.
